Output 7ebd60c089300dc7461f8007ab12e162c7d05825f1781aa0aee0429933abf6cf:1

value
51269779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bd9e0e9c13167d021ab97a3e3ae7aaaa47581fb OP_EQUAL
address
MTwdDuh2cQ1F8F1LjMiGp4qFDsdqA6tEaW
transaction
7ebd60c089300dc7461f8007ab12e162c7d05825f1781aa0aee0429933abf6cf
spent
true